    							Send a fax to multiple recipients
    You can send a fax to multiple recipients at once by grouping individual speed dial entries
    into group speed dial entries.
    To send a fax to multiple recipients from the control panel
    1.Load your originals print side up into the document feeder tray. If you are sending a
    single-page fax, such as a photograph, you can also load your original print side down
    on the glass.
    NOTE:If you are sending a multiple-page fax, you must load the originals in the
    document feeder tray. You cannot fax a multiple-page document from the glass.
    2.Press Speed Dial repeatedly, until the appropriate group speed dial entry appears.
    TIP:You can also scroll through the speed dial entries by pressing  or , or
    you can select a speed dial entry by entering its speed dial code using the keypad
    on the control panel.
    3.Press Start Fax Black.
    •If the device detects an original loaded in the automatic document feeder,
    the HP All-in-One sends the document to each number in the group speed dial
    entry.
    •If the device does not detect an original loaded in the automatic document
    feeder, the Fax from glass? prompt appears. Make sure your original is loaded
    on the glass, and then press 1 to select Yes.
    NOTE:You can only use group speed dial entries to send faxes in black and
    white, because of memory limitations. The HP All-in-One scans the fax into
    memory then dials the first number. When a connection is made, the HP All-in-
    One sends the fax and dials the next number. If a number is busy or not answering,
    the HP All-in-One follows the settings for Busy Redial and No Answer Redial.
    If a connection cannot be made, the next number is dialed and an error report is
    generated.

    Send a color original or photo fax
    You can fax a color original or photo from the HP All-in-One. If the HP All-in-One
    determines that the recipients fax machine only supports black-and-white faxes, the
    HP All-in-One sends the fax in black and white.
    HP recommends that you use only color originals for color faxing.
    Send a fax 89
     
    						
    							To send a color original or photo fax from the control panel
    1.Load your originals print side up into the document feeder tray. If you are sending a
    single-page fax, such as a photograph, you can also load your original print side down
    on the glass.
    NOTE:If you are sending a multiple-page fax, you must load the originals in the
    document feeder tray. You cannot fax a multiple-page document from the glass.
    TIP:To center a 10 x 15 cm (4 x 6 inch) photo, place the photo on the center of
    a blank letter- or A4-size sheet of paper, and then place the original on the glass.
    2.In the Fax area, press Menu.
    The Enter Number prompt appears.
    3.Enter the fax number by using the keypad, press Speed Dial or a one-touch speed
    dial button to select a speed dial, or press Redial/Pause to redial the last number
    dialed.
    4.Press Start Fax Color.
    •If the device detects an original loaded in the automatic document feeder,
    the HP All-in-One sends the document to the number you entered.
    •If the device does not detect an original loaded in the automatic document
    feeder, the Fax from glass? prompt appears. Make sure your original is loaded
    on the glass, and then press 1 to select Yes.
    NOTE:If the recipients fax machine only supports black-and-white faxes, the
    HP All-in-One automatically sends the fax in black and white. A message appears
    after the fax has been sent indicating that the fax was sent in black and white.
    Press OK to clear the message.

    Change the fax resolution
    The Resolution setting affects the transmission speed and quality of faxed black-and-
    white documents. If the receiving fax machine does not support the resolution you have
    chosen, the HP All-in-One sends faxes at the highest resolution supported by the
    receiving fax machine.
    Chapter 10
    90 Use the fax features
     
    						
    							NOTE:You can only change the resolution for faxes that you are sending in black
    and white. The HP All-in-One sends all color faxes using Fine resolution.
    The following resolution settings are available for sending faxes: Fine, Very Fine,
    Photo, and Standard.
    •Fine: provides high-quality text suitable for faxing most documents. This is the default
    setting. When sending faxes in color, the HP All-in-One always uses the Fine setting.
    •Very Fine: provides the best quality fax when you are faxing documents with very
    fine detail. If you choose Very Fine, be aware that the faxing process takes longer to
    complete and you can only send black-and-white faxes using this resolution. If you
    send a color fax, it will be sent using Fine resolution instead.
    •Photo: provides the best quality fax when sending photographs in black and white.
    If you choose Photo, be aware that the faxing process takes longer to complete.
    When faxing photographs in black and white, HP recommends that you choose
    Photo.
    •Standard: provides the fastest possible fax transmission with the lowest quality.
    When you exit the Fax menu, this option returns to the default setting unless you set your
    changes as the default.

    Send a fax in Error Correction Mode
    Error Correction Mode (ECM) prevents loss of data due to poor phone lines by detecting
    errors that occur during transmission and automatically requesting retransmission of the
    erroneous portion. Phone charges are unaffected, or might even be reduced, on good
    phone lines. On poor phone lines, ECM increases sending time and phone charges, but
    sends the data much more reliably. The default setting is On. Turn ECM off only if it
    Chapter 10
    92 Use the fax features
     
    						
    							increases phone charges substantially, and you can accept poorer quality in exchange
    for reduced charges.
    Before turning the ECM setting off, consider the following. If you turn ECM off
    •The quality and transmission speed of faxes you send and receive are affected.
    •The Fax Speed is automatically set to Medium.
    •You will no longer be able to send or receive faxes in color.
    To change the ECM setting from the control panel
    1.Press Setup.
    2.Press 5, and then press 6.
    This selects Advanced Fax Setup and then selects Error Correction Mode.
    3.Press 
     to select On or Off.
    4.Press OK.
    Receive a fax
    The HP All-in-One can receive faxes automatically or manually. If you turn off the Auto
    Answer option, you will need to receive faxes manually. If you turn on the Auto
    Answer option (the default setting), the HP All-in-One automatically answers incoming
    calls and receives faxes after the number of rings specified by the Rings to Answer
    setting. (The default Rings to Answer setting is five rings.)
    You can receive faxes manually from a phone that is:
    •Directly connected to the HP All-in-One (on the 2-EXT port)
    •On the same telephone line, but not directly connected to the HP All-in-One
    If you receive a legal-size fax and the HP All-in-One is not currently set to use legal-size
    paper, the device reduces the fax so that it fits on the paper that is loaded in the HP All-
    in-One. If you have disabled the Automatic Reduction feature, the HP All-in-One might
    print the fax on more than one page.

    Set up backup fax reception
    Depending on your preference and security requirements, you can set up the HP All-in-
    One to store all the faxes it receives, only the faxes it receives while the device is in an
    error condition, or none of the faxes it receives.
    The following Backup Fax Reception modes are available:
    OnThe default setting. When Backup Fax Reception is On, the HP All-in-One
    stores all faxes it receives in memory. This enables you to reprint up to eight
    of the most recently printed faxes if they are still saved in memory.
    NOTE:When the memory gets low, the HP All-in-One overwrites the
    oldest, printed faxes as it receives new faxes. If the memory becomes full
    of unprinted faxes, the HP All-in-One will stop answering incoming fax calls.
    NOTE:If you receive a fax that is too large, such as a very detailed color
    photo, it might not be stored in memory due to memory limitations.
    On Error OnlyCauses the HP All-in-One to store faxes in memory only if there is an error
    condition that prevents the HP All-in-One from printing the faxes (for
    example, if the HP All-in-One runs out of paper). The HP All-in-One will
    continue to store incoming faxes as long as there is memory available. (If
    the memory becomes full, the HP All-in-One will stop answering incoming
    fax calls.) When the error condition is resolved, the faxes stored in memory
    print automatically and are then deleted from memory.
    OffMeans that faxes are never stored in memory. (You might want to turn
    off Backup Fax Reception for security purposes, for example.) If an error
    Chapter 10
    94 Use the fax features
     
    						
    							condition occurs that prevents the HP All-in-One from printing (for example,
    the HP All-in-One runs out of paper), the HP All-in-One will stop answering
    incoming fax calls.
    NOTE:If Backup Fax Reception is enabled and you turn off the HP All-in-One, all
    faxes stored in memory are deleted, including any unprinted faxes that you might have
    received while the HP All-in-One was in an error condition. You will need to contact
    the senders to ask them to resend any unprinted faxes. For a list of the faxes you
    have received, print the Fax Log. The Fax Log is not deleted when the HP All-in-One
    is turned off.
    To set backup fax reception from the control panel
    1.Press Setup.
    2.Press 5, and then press 5 again.
    This selects Advanced Fax Setup and then selects Backup Fax Reception.
    3.Press 
     to select On, On Error Only, or Off.
    4.Press OK.

    Poll to receive a fax
    Polling allows the HP All-in-One to ask another fax machine to send a fax that it has in
    its queue. When you use the Poll to Receive feature, the HP All-in-One calls the
    designated fax machine and requests the fax from it. The designated fax machine must
    be set for polling and have a fax ready to send.
    NOTE:The HP All-in-One does not support polling pass codes. Polling pass codes
    are a security feature that require the receiving fax machine to provide a pass code
    to the device it is polling in order to receive the fax. Make sure the device you are
    polling does not have a pass code set up (or has not changed the default pass code)
    or the HP All-in-One will not be able to receive the fax.
    To set up poll to receive a fax from the control panel
    1.In the Fax area, press Menu repeatedly until How to Fax appears.
    2.Press 
     until Poll to Receive appears, and then press OK.
    3.Enter the fax number of the other fax machine.
    4.Press Start Fax Black or Start Fax Color.
    NOTE:If you press Start Fax Color but the sender sent the fax in black and
    white, the HP All-in-One prints the fax in black and white.
    Forward faxes to another number
    You can set up the HP All-in-One to forward your faxes to another fax number. If you
    receive a color fax, the HP All-in-One forwards the fax in black and white.
    HP recommends that you verify the number you are forwarding to is a working fax line.
    Send a test fax to make sure the fax machine is able to receive your forwarded faxes.
    To forward faxes from the control panel
    1.Press Setup.
    2.Press 5, and then press 8.
    This selects Advanced Fax Setup and then selects Fax Forwarding Black Only.
    Chapter 10
    96 Use the fax features
     
    						
    							3.Press  until On-Forward or On-Print & Forward appears, and then press OK.
    • Choose On-Forward if you want to forward the fax to another number without
    printing a backup copy on the HP All-in-One.
    NOTE:If the HP All-in-One is not able to forward the fax to the designated
    fax machine (if it is not turned on, for example), the HP All-in-One will print the
    fax. If you set up the HP All-in-One to print error reports for received faxes, it
    will also print an error report.
    • Choose On-Print & Forward to print a backup copy of your received fax on the
    HP All-in-One while forwarding the fax to another number.
    4.At the prompt, enter the number of the fax machine that will receive the forwarded
    faxes.
    5.At the prompt, enter a start time and date and a stop time and date.
    6.Press OK.
    Fax Forwarding appears on the display.
    If the HP All-in-One loses power when Fax Forwarding is set up, the HP All-in-One
    saves the Fax Forwarding setting and phone number. When power is restored to
    the device, the Fax Forwarding setting is still On.
    NOTE:You can cancel fax forwarding by pressing Cancel on the control panel
    when the Fax Forwarding message is visible on the display, or you can select
    Off from the Fax Forwarding Black Only menu.

    Set automatic reduction for incoming faxes
    The Automatic Reduction setting determines what the HP All-in-One does if it receives
    a fax that is too large for the default paper size. This setting is turned on by default, so
    the image of the incoming fax is reduced to fit on one page, if possible. If this feature is
    turned off, information that does not fit on the first page is printed on a second page.
    Automatic Reduction is useful when you receive a legal-size fax and letter-size paper
    is loaded in the input tray.
    Receive a fax 97
     
    						
    							To set automatic reduction from the control panel
    1.Press Setup.
    2.Press 5, and then press 4.
    This selects Advanced Fax Setup and then selects Automatic Reduction.
    3.Press 
     to select Off or On.
    4.Press OK.
    Block junk fax numbers
    If you subscribe to a caller ID service through your phone provider, you can block specific
    fax numbers, so the HP All-in-One does not print faxes received from those numbers in
    the future. When an incoming fax call is received, the HP All-in-One compares the number
    to the list of junk fax numbers you set up to determine if the call should be blocked. If the
    number matches a number in the blocked fax numbers list, the fax is not printed. (The
    maximum number of fax numbers you can block varies by model.)
